World stroke day at NUREL – 29 October

29 October marks world stroke day, a date dedicated to highlighting the vital importance of prevention and early detection. Stroke is currently the second leading cause of death and the third leading cause of disability worldwide. In Spain, between 110,000 and 120,000 new cases are recorded each year, with a particularly high incidence among women.

Every year, World Stroke Day aims to increase global awareness regarding prevention, detection, and the necessity of rapid action when the first symptoms appear.

NUREL completes Phase III of its energy storage facility project

NUREL, committed to energy efficiency and industrial sustainability, has completed Phase III of the energy storage installation project at its facilities in Zaragoza.

This new system will allow the company to optimise electricity consumption, reduce its reliance on the grid, and promote the integration of renewable energies into its production processes.

The Phase III energy storage installation has a total capacity of 4,472 kWh and a power output of 2,236 kW, configured within a single container that integrates all the necessary equipment for the safe and efficient operation of the system.
